Gender Without Identity with authors Avgi Saketopoulou and Ann Pellegrini
Psychoanalysts Avgi Saketopoulou and Ann Pellegrini challenge the idea of 'core gender identity' and argue that all genders and sexualities are shaped by complex processes, not innate. They discuss how trauma can lead to growth and transformation in queer and trans identities, emphasizing that trauma does not make individuals 'broken'.

Avgi Saketopoulou and Ann Pellegrini, "Gender Without Identity" (Unconscious in Translation, 2023)
Authors Avgi Saketopoulou and Ann Pellegrini challenge static notions of gender identity, advocating for a more fluid understanding that evolves over time. They discuss the complex interplay between gender, trauma, and societal influences, emphasizing the importance of providing a safe space for individuals to explore their gender identity. The podcast explores the intersection of self-theorization, agency, and gender in relational contexts, highlighting the need for diverse perspectives in psychoanalysis.
